Denim insulation has an NRC average of 1.15 and an STC value of 52, making it ideal for soundproofing applications. Those that are deflected get trapped in voids or pores, which convert the frequency energy into heat. Soundwave frequencies penetrate the insulation and bounce off the different facets of the fiber, or are caught in the pores. The fiber and insulation structure work together to improve soundproofing. The manufacturing process also ensures there are voids within the compressed panels. The fibers are multi-dimensional, porous, and dense. Insulation made from blue jeans and other cotton products is good for soundproofing. Is Denim Insulation Good for Soundproofing? The cotton material is easy to work with, has no VOC off-gassing, or irritating carcinogenic filaments. It can also be used in acoustic traps, panels, and to wrap plumbing, duct, and HVAC pipes. There is more surface area within the material to interrupt and transform sound energy into heat.ĭenim sound insulation cuts sound transmission through walls, floors, and ceilings. The porosity and density of the insulation, coupled with the fiber shape, contribute to denim’s superior STC rating of 52, and NRC value of 1.15. The porous, multi-dimensional natural fibers of blue jeans insulation make for excellent sound absorbency.
